The division of labor is essential for social stability from "summary" of The Republic of Plato by Plato
In our ideal society, each individual is naturally suited to a specific role based on their abilities and talents. This division of labor is not only practical but also essential for maintaining social stability. By assigning tasks according to each person's strengths, we ensure that the community functions smoothly and efficiently. When individuals focus on what they excel at, they can contribute their best to the collective good. Furthermore, the division of labor leads to interdependence among citizens. As each person relies on others to fulfill different needs, a sense of unity and cooperation is fostered. This mutual reliance creates a sense of connection and solidarity within the community. When individuals recognize the importance of their role in the larger societal framework, they are more likely to work together harmoniously towards common goals. Moreover, the division of labor helps to prevent conflict and competition among individuals. When everyone is clear about their responsibilities and respects the roles of others, there is less room for jealousy or resentment. Each person understands the value of their contribution and recognizes the significance of the contributions of others. This recognition leads to a sense of appreciation and respect for the diverse talents and skills that each person brings to the community. In addition, the division of labor promotes efficiency and specialization. When individuals focus on specific tasks, they can hone their skills and expertise in that particular area. This specialization leads to higher productivity and quality of work. By allowing individuals to excel in their respective roles, the overall functioning of society is improved. This efficiency benefits everyone in the community, as each person's efforts contribute to the greater good.- The division of labor is a fundamental aspect of our social structure. It not only ensures that each individual can contribute meaningfully to society but also fosters a sense of unity, cooperation, and mutual respect. By recognizing and embracing the unique abilities of each person, we can create a harmonious and stable community where everyone can thrive and fulfill their potential.
